2026 Proxy Season Review: Structural Change in a Lower-Volume Season
The 2026 proxy season was shaped less by volume than by procedural change. Proposal filings continued to decline, the number of activism campaigns fell sharply, and say-on-pay support improved—even as boards faced heightened legal complexity, more fragmented voting influence, and a regulatory environment in flux.
